The Origins of Moissanite

Moissanite has a unique tale that starts in the stars. In 1893, Dr. Henri Moissan found tiny crystals in a crater. These crystals were from a meteor and like diamonds. But they were not diamonds - they were moissanite. This gem is rare on Earth. Now, we make moissanite in labs. It shines bright and is tough like a diamond. Many people like it for its sparkle and strength. Plus, it costs less than diamonds. This makes it big in hip hop bling.

What Makes Moissanite Stand Out?

Moissanite is turning heads in the hip hop world. Its unique qualities make it standout. It shines brighter than diamonds, thanks to its high refractive index. Moissanite also lasts a long time. It's almost as hard as diamonds, which is great for everyday wear. Unlike diamonds, moissanite is less likely to attract dirt and oil. This means it keeps its sparkle longer. Plus, it's eco-friendly. Moissanite is lab-made which causes less harm to the earth. Lastly, it’s more affordable, making bling accessible to more fans. It’s easy to see why moissanite is a star in hip hop jewelry.
